Description

The Loft, a family home that rises above the rest! Tucked away in the charming village of Hilderstone, The Loft is anything but ordinary. This unique and beautifully designed family home offers generous living space, bold architectural features, and a fresh take on village life, for those craving something a little different. Step through the fabulous porch entrance and you’ll immediately get a sense of scale. This is a home built for families who love space to breathe, gather, and grow. Inside, the ground floor truly shines. A vast living room makes a statement with a striking glass wall overlooking the garden, while bifold doors invite the outdoors in. A log-burning stove on a slate base promises cosy evenings, and there’s more room to spread out in the eye-catching dining room, with exposed brickwork and garden-facing glass panels letting the light pour in. At the heart of the home lies a sleek kitchen-diner, perfect for feeding the troops or entertaining friends. From here, you’ll find a handy WC, utility room, boot room, and a stylish wet room…every inch designed with family life in mind. Upstairs, four bedrooms provide plenty of room for kids, guests, or working from home. The main bedroom is a special retreat, accessed by its own spiral staircase, arriving at a generous landing space ideal for a study or reading nook. Step through to the main bedroom, complete with a modern en suite and freestanding bath. The family bathroom also delivers luxury, with a large corner tub perfect for a relaxing soak. Skylights throughout the upper floor flood the home with natural light, creating a bright, uplifting feel in every corner. Outside, the surprises continue. A large garage complete with a workshop, mezzanine storage, and even its own log burner, ideal for hobbies, tinkering, or just stashing all that essential family gear. A generous lawn is perfect for play, while the paved and gravelled garden area makes al fresco dining a breeze. Mature trees and sweeping country views create a peaceful setting, with a secluded bench spot just right for quiet moments, nature-watching, or storytime under the sky. Set on a private driveway in the ever-popular village of Hilderstone, just 10 minutes from Stone and within easy reach of Stafford. The Loft is a rare find: a home full of character, light, and space, designed to embrace busy family life with ease and style. Families looking for space, soul, and something a little different… come and discover life at The Loft.

  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
